Clinical Billing Job Avenues and Income Trends in India
The demand for skilled medical documentation specialists in India is steadily increasing, fueled by the expansion of the hospitality sector and a transition towards electronic health records. Several opportunities exist in private practices, payer organizations, BPO companies, and even work-from-home settings. Today, entry-level coders can typically expect a salary ranging from ₹15,000 to ₹30,000 per month, while senior professionals with advanced skills can command ₹40,000 to ₹80,000 or greater per month. The standard wage is anticipated to stay on an upward trajectory as the sector keeps to progress. Qualifications such as AHIMA also substantially impact salary expectations.
